Crime overview

System Street area has the 7th lowest crime rate of 28 local areas in Adamsdown , and the 415th highest crime rate of 1,028 local areas in Cardiff .

The streets immediately around this postcode mostly have high or very high crime levels, and on average the bordering areas are much more affected by crime than this postcode itself.

The overall crime rate in the area around System Street (CF24 0JG) in the last 12 months was 85.7 per 1,000 residents and was 57.2% lower than the Adamsdown average (200.2 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 11 offences recorded. The least common crime was Theft from the person with 1 case , unchanged from 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Anti-social behaviour ( 200.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Vehicle crime ( -50.0%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 14 (β‰ˆ 44.4 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 40.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-70.9%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around System Street (CF24 0JG), the main crime hotspot is near Petrol Station. Police recorded 148 crimes here, including 72 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
